Output 668b1ea16ebb9b5834b10d3886249b81d2e9a583d9af4b3d947db89d34fed416:0

value
202223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da7a7d9e1e7efbeea13c2e23773b837bd977653 OP_EQUAL
address
3Ec23WeHe7bYS22F9sMbvDydTCeujjjhq1
transaction
668b1ea16ebb9b5834b10d3886249b81d2e9a583d9af4b3d947db89d34fed416
spent
true